Output 5f2e8dca17c42a59c48f9484e3e3aa2b18068a89b113f55c9b6da07d19b1286e:3

value
284133932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81c024db96fc6bd5a63089343a5570c007d2b502 OP_EQUAL
address
3DX5GgpX4JH2hhkJxipfA7fpFP65N4CHQo
transaction
5f2e8dca17c42a59c48f9484e3e3aa2b18068a89b113f55c9b6da07d19b1286e
confirmations
418755
spent
true